Description

As Lonesome Valley kicks off the holiday season with its annual parade, artist Amanda Trent embraces the Christmas spirit, happy that her family will be coming to town to celebrate the season with her and her loyal pets, Laddie, a friendly golden retriever, and Mona Lisa, an independent calico cat.

Amanda has just one nagging concern: her art sales have stalled, so her checking account is starting to look a bit puny. Her financial woes pale, though, in comparison to her concern when several people eat carrot bars laced with hemlock at the high school's arts and crafts fair, resulting in one unlucky man's death. Was the poisoning an accident, or did someone with evil intent deliberately spike the sweet baked goods?

Leads the police follow don't pan out until Amanda puts the puzzle together. But, sometimes, knowledge can be a dangerous thing. . .

    Hemlock for the Holidays is book #3 in the Fine Art Mystery series by Paula Darnell. Amanda is getting ready for her kids and parents coming to visit for Christmas while worrying about a lack of sales of her artwork. She has a lot going on and then people get sick at a crafts fair. I find Amanda to be very relatable - the finances, the being uncomfortable selling her art, the love for her pets. She has great friends and an interesting profession. The mystery was interesting and there were plenty of suspects to keep you guessing. I received a copy of this book from BookSprout and am voluntarily leaving an honest review.
